Let your group know your plans to discuss the sermon. This will encourage them to listen carefully and take notes in preparation. Apply the sermon yourself. To lead a good discussion, be sure to prepare yourself. Listen to the sermon, think about the connections and implications, and pray for insight and conviction from the Spirit.5. “Pinwheel”. When you are leading a discussion, it's important to offer your team support and guidance. …The skillful leader opens the discussion with a brief statement of the question and the salient facts related to it. This takes perhaps five minutes. Then he starts the discussion with a pointed question. Listen in to hear our hosts discuss how loneliness can make a person feel unwanted and uncared for – even if they are standing in a crowded room...Focus on the lesson your group studied. It’s easy to get off track when leading or participating in group discussions, but let the lesson be your guide. Stick to the content covered that week to keep discussion time intentional and productive. Keep it broad. Usually, general questions will generate better discussion than very specific questions.

To lead a debate, divide students into two groups with each one representing one side of the argument. You can give them a passage to read about the topic and some facts or perhaps give one side facts to support its argument while giving a different set of facts to the other. 5. Protect everyone's chance to speak. As a team leader, you need to create a safe environment where your team members feel heard and respected. You need to safeguard their chances to speak up and check the interrupters on your team. Some people are more comfortable speaking up in public. Some aren't.Wrap up and follow up on the discussion. To wrap up a productive group discussion, you should summarize the main points, insights, and outcomes of the discussion.
